Just because they say it's HPI clear doesn't mean it's not had an accident in Japan (or indeed here). After market steering wheels on standard cars always make me wonder.

As long as it's straight it's cheap enough. Hell, if it were closer I'd buy it as a project car.

It also has an aftermarket induction kit, may be worth having a thorough check for other engine mods, battery could have been moved to make way for some other changes. Any thing done to the engine will have a hefty effect on insurance premium.

 

Leather didnt come as standard and is amongst several interior mods. In your friends place Id want a definitive list of all mods before taking the plunge.

OK, went to look at the car yesterday.

 

Not exactly a minter! Has at some point taken a front end knock (hard to tell how bad but possibly only a light knock?)

 

Engine I think has been swapped at some point, but to be fair sounds quite sweet and no smoke on start up or even after idle. (and there is oil in it :) )

 

Whole car has seen paint at some point and in places it looks a bit rough but the masking job they have done is quite good?

 

Interior a bit ropey and needs some tidying. Dash scratches, fair amount of wear and tear on seats etc.

 

Bit of a shock, has had 10 owners! and comes with no supporting service history.

 

All this said, the guy bought it knowing nothing about Supras and found that when he came to insure it its way too much for him!

 

Overall the car is a little rough but could be a reasonable project or doner car for someone who is looking to get a cheap Sup to begin with as you may be able to do a deal with him?

 

Not for us though..
